Segra is a leading independent fiber network company in the Eastern United States, recognized for its expansive service footprint across the mid-Atlantic and Southeast regions. With a focus on delivering cutting-edge voice and data technology solutions, Segra provides state-of-the-art infrastructure that supports businesses and public sector clients alike. The company excels in offering top-tier wholesale transport services to some of the world’s largest carriers, leveraging advanced IP, ethernet, and dark fiber architectures. Its high-performance data centers across the mid-Atlantic and Southeast bolster its reputation for reliability and innovation. Job Duties
- Plan, manage, and execute events from concept through completion, including internal events, client events, tradeshows, promotions, sales incentives, and ticket requests
- Manage all event logistics, including venue sourcing and booking, vendor coordination, event setup, and breakdown
- Partner with cross-functional teams to promote events and develop strategies to maximize attendance, brand exposure, and audience engagement
- Maintain a comprehensive annual event calendar
- Collaborate with sales leadership to develop and execute market-specific event strategies that drive sales objectives
- Develop and manage event budgets, timelines, and logistics plans
- Coordinate with external vendors on catering, audiovisual needs, signage, and other event requirements
- Travel extensively to event locations across the United States
- Compile post-event reports including event metrics, attendee feedback, ROI insights, and recommendations for improvement
- Manage promotional materials, displays, and inventory related to events and tradeshows
- Track execution timelines and expenses for each event
- Support and manage onsite execution of tradeshows and events
- Provide regular status updates on event progress, sales impact, budgets, and project plans
- Assist with the production and coordination of marketing materials for events
- Provide day-to-day support to the marketing team on marketing and communication initiatives
